Reinforced Space Films

ORCON's family of Orcofilm ORCON reinforced KaptonŽ and MylarŽ space films have been specially developed to meet the space industry's need for strong, but lightweight, films for Multilayer Insulation blankets and other spacecraft applications.

Spacecraft MLI blankets made with unreinforced films are prone to accidental ripping during blanket installation and spacecraft testing. By using reinforced films on the outboard and/or inboard side of the blanket, much of this ripping can be prevented, reducing the cost of blanket repair and schedule delays.

ORCON uses its proprietary Bonded Oriented Continuous Strand (BOCS) technology to apply Nomex reinforcing yarns to one face of the film. The advantage of the BOCS process is its unique method of securing the yarn to the film. Instead of coating the entire film surface with adhesive, the BOCS method applies adhesive only to the yarns in one direction. This minimizes the amount of adhesive, making ORCON reinforced films much lighter in weight than competing reinforced films, while easily meeting strict outgassing requirements. Also, the open pattern of ORCON's reinforcing permits direct access to the film surface for static grounding.

Using ORCON reinforced space films, MLI blanket designers can replace thick, heavy external film layers with thinner reinforced films that are much stronger, yet weigh less, than the thick film. The cost benefits from fewer blanket repairs and lighter weight can be significant, especially on large communications satellites.

SPECIFICATIONS
 
Reinforced Space Films
AN-90D 0.5-mil (12.7 micron) Mylar, aluminized one side, reinforced on aluminized side.
 
AN-90PD Same as AN-90D, with perforations.
 
AN-108 Lamination of 2 layers reinforced 0.5-mil Tedlar, aluminized inside for static dissipation. NASA-KSC Group 1 protective cover film.
 
KN-90D 1-mil (25.4 micron) Black 100XC Kapton (10E7 ohm/sq.). Reinforced one side. Not metallized.
 
KN-90GD Same as KN-90D, with germanium applied to non-reinforced side of film.
 
KN-92PD 0.5-mil (12.7 micron) Kapton, aluminized one side, with perforations. Reinforced on aluminized side.
 
KN-94D 1.6-mil (40.6 micron) Black 160XC Kapton (360 ohm/sq.). Reinforced one side. Not metallized.
 
KN-94PD Same as KN-94D, with perforations.
 
KN-99D 1-mil (25.4 micron) Black 100XC Kapton (10E7 ohm/sq.). Aluminized one side. Reinforced on aluminized side.  

Notes:
1) All reinforcing is 200 denier Nomex yarn in 4x4 yarns per inch pattern.
2) Standard Perforations provide 1%-2% open area for ventillation.
